php 工程师面试题,PHP工程师面试题

1. 把PHP.ini 里的 display_errors = On 才可以显示错误位置

2. 习惯使用echo 或者 print 打印

3. 使用注释来屏蔽符号来调试

// ……….

/*…...

2015-11-29 09:01:55

1、尽量完整的需求方案,具体到每个功能点上

2、建模结构UML,通过UML工具建立专业的模或自己画一个简单的关系图。

3、建立数据库

1)、建立的表名、字段名要与他的功能有关系英文不好的拼音同样可以

...

2015-11-28 11:05:09

1.解释一下PHP里面的三元运算符

举例说明:a= b==c? 1 : 2 ,若b==c,则a的值为1 否则a的值为2

2.如何知道有几个参数传入到了一个function?

func_num_args...

2015-11-28 09:47:22

1.include和require有什么区别?

区别在于他们如何处理失败, 如果require的文件没有找到, 会造成fatal error,脚本停止执行,如果include的文件没有找到, 会显示警...

2015-11-27 07:40:13

使用 Function 来自定义一个函数:

格式为:

Function func_name($val){

……

}

函数的命名跟自定义变量一样,只能使用 _, A~Z, a~z

一...

在往PHP Session里面保存信息之前,需要首先使用session_start()函数来启动session, 这个函数必须在标签之前调用。代码如下:

在Session启动以后,可以使用P...

删除一个Cookie值,可以把过期日期设置到一个已经过去的时间

代码如下:

// set the expiration date to one hour ago

setcookie(...

1. 給你一行文字 $string,你會如何編寫一個正規表達式,把 $string 內的 HTML 標籤除去?

2. PHP 和 Perl 分辨陣列和散列表的方法有什麼差異?

3. 你如何利用 PHP...

PHP的mail()函数可以实现直接用脚本发送邮件。

用mail()函数发送邮件之前,首先需要在php.ini文件里面设置一下邮件服务属性,主要的设置选项如下:

属性 缺省值 说明 ...

四种标量类型:

boolean(布尔型) 理解为真假型

integer(整型)

float(浮点型,也作“double”) 理解为小数型

string(字符串)

两种复合类型:

array(数组)

o...

第一种方法:可以使用如下方法对用户密码进行加密:MySql>SET user@”localhost” PASSWORD=PASSWORD(”Password”);

第二种方法:可以使用MYSQL...

2015-11-23 11:40:15

1、有一个论坛,帖子的数据巨大,请简要说明如何提高用户搜索帖子的效率。

在程序方面,可以使用页面缓存技术。在前台界面着设计方面也可以让用户输入多一些的关键字,比如帖子的标题,发贴人的id,时间等,这样...

php调用mysql存储过程和函数的两种方法存储过程和函数是MySql5.0刚刚引入的。关于这方面的操作在PHP里面没有直接的支持。但是由于Mysql PHP API的设计,使得我们可以在以前的PHP...

2015-11-22 09:31:38

1、用PHP打印出前一天的时间,格式是2006-5-10 22:21:21

//echo date('Y-m-d H:i:s',time()-60*60*24

echo date(...

PHP函数setcookie()用来设置cookie.

setcookie()函数必须在标签之前调用,语法是setcookie (name, value, expire, path, domain) ...

1. 用PHP打印出前一天的时间,打印格式是2007年5月10日 22:21:21

2. PHP代码如下:

$a=”hello”;

$b=&$a;

unset($b);

$b=”world”;

ech...

php模板引擎smarty内置的一些操作函数,我们称之为变量操作符,变量操作符可用于操作变量,自定义函数和字符。(跟我PHP中常用的PHP内部函数类似)

他可以帮助我们完成很多比较实用的功能,如:首字...

2015-11-19 09:45:42

1. Which of the following will not add john to the users array?

1. $users[] = ‘john’;

2. array_add($...

1、不用新变量直接交换现有两个变量的值. (考php基本功)

答案:list($a, $b) = array($b, $a);

2、PHP数字金额转大小格式,同时说明思路 (考数组掌握)

3、S...

$message是个简单的变量,$$message是变量的变量,表示这个变量的值。例如$user = ‘zhangsan’ 相当于 $message = ‘user’; $$message = ‘zh...

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值